Decision-taking is one of the key activities in tribal households. Decisions may be taken individually or by involving other members of the family, or collectively by involving members of the group or the community.Several socio-personal factors play a major role, while taking a decision in the family. It is observed that the decision-making patterns of all the tribal households was different. Breeding decisions were taken collectively i.e. both by husband and wife in Todas, Kotas and Kurumbas except paniyas, Irulas and Kattunaickas where the husband was taking the decision.Practice wise pooled data of feeding activities shows that the husband had maximum involvement in decision-taking followed by wives. The findings reflect that both husband and wife play a major role in decision taking either individually or collectively.
